From: <var...@us...> - 2021-09-17 13:25:47
|
Revision: 10564 http://sourceforge.net/p/phpwiki/code/10564 Author: vargenau Date: 2021-09-17 13:25:45 +0000 (Fri, 17 Sep 2021) Log Message: ----------- Better test with array_key_exists to avoid warning Modified Paths: -------------- trunk/lib/WikiDB/backend/dbaBase.php Modified: trunk/lib/WikiDB/backend/dbaBase.php =================================================================== --- trunk/lib/WikiDB/backend/dbaBase.php 2021-09-17 11:14:06 UTC (rev 10563) +++ trunk/lib/WikiDB/backend/dbaBase.php 2021-09-17 13:25:45 UTC (rev 10564) @@ -819,12 +819,12 @@ $links = $this->_get_links($reversed ? 'i' : 'o', $page); $linksonly = array(); foreach ($links as $link) { // linkto => page, linkrelation => page - if (is_array($link) and isset($link['relation'])) { + if (is_array($link) and array_key_exists('relation', $link)) { if ($link['relation']) $this->found_relations++; $linksonly[] = array('pagename' => $link['linkto'], 'linkrelation' => $link['relation']); - } else { // empty relations are stripped + } elseif (array_key_exists('linkto', $link)) { // empty relations are stripped $linksonly[] = array('pagename' => $link['linkto']); } } This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|